The Steam release includes the game’s Version 2.0 update, featuring major new features and improvements, as well as the Adventurer Packet (available to purchase separately on consoles and the Epic Games Store after the Steam launch), an art book, and the award-winning original soundtrack by Óscar Araujo. Version 2.0 content arrives on May 14 as a free update across all platforms and brings a wide range of enhancements.
That includes New Game+, a new difficulty tier (Titanium), plus new weapon parts and skins (available only in New Game+). Elements Transmutation lets players change material types. There is also a photo mode and a Boss Revival Mode (a new mode where you can fight bosses again and earn rewards). Adso‘s spells add deeper combat flavor via weapon enhancements (rewards tied to Boss Revival Mode that improve weapon capabilities with special effects). And yes, you can pet the ox.
Additional improvements include expanded death and dismemberment animation variations, improved animation transitions, Nvidia DLSS 4 implementation, fully remappable keyboard and mouse bindings, new achievements, and Steam Deck support.
Blades of Fire launched on May 22 for PlayStation 5, Xbox Series, and PC via the Epic Games Store. It arrives on Steam on May 14 alongside the Version 2.0 update.
